My PhD program was very interdisciplinary and included Advanced Math, Statistics, Nutrition, Toxicology, Advanced Biochemistry, Exposure Science, Public Health Policy, Computer Programming in R and technical writing that led to 5 peer-reviewed publications. I've tutored students in Advanced Nutrition (gene-nutrient interaction), SAT prep (critical reading and math), AP Statistics, College Statistics and look forward to fully utilizing my previous PhD experience as I intend to offer tutoring in a variety and math, science and writing subjects.

I am a Chess Coach for elementary schools in Maryland and Virginia. I have a 1730 USCF rating and an "Expert" performance rating in my last tournament. I can improve your chess game through a conventional approach reinforced with computer-learning tools which I used to improve my chess game dramatically from a beginner to a solid intermediate player in a very short time.

What is your teaching philosophy?

My goal is to improve the way in which students problem-solve in order to improve critical thinking skills and test scores.

What might you do in a typical first session with a student?

During the first session with a student, it is important to evaluate problem-solving skills and experience in the subject. After the assessment, I will help students improve in both areas.

How can you help a student become an independent learner?

I work on improving a student's critical-thinking skills, which can be used beyond the current homework assignment, test, or problem set.
